    Getting There

    Car

    If you're driving from the center of Sima, head south on the main road towards Moroni. Continue straight for about 15 minutes until you reach the junction near Meck. Take a right turn towards VoloVolo Sud. After approximately 5 minutes, Comores Market VoloVolo will be on your left. Parking is available near the market.

    Public Transportation (Taxi)

    To reach Comores Market VoloVolo by taxi, find a local taxi service in Sima. Inform the driver that you want to go to 'VoloVolo Sud vers Meck.' The ride should take around 25 minutes, and the fare typically ranges from 500 to 1000 KMF, depending on the driver and time of day.

    Public Transportation (Bus)

    If you prefer using public buses, locate the nearest bus station in Sima. Take a bus heading towards Moroni. After about 30 minutes, ask the driver to drop you off at the VoloVolo stop. From there, it’s a short walk (approximately 5 minutes) along the road towards Comores Market VoloVolo, which will be on your left. The bus fare is usually around 300 KMF.

    Local tips

    Visit early in the morning for the freshest produce and to avoid crowds.
    Don't miss trying the local snacks and street food available in the market.
    Bring cash, as some vendors may not accept credit cards.
    Engage with local vendors to learn about their products and get the best recommendations.
